    I already added the rest of the controls to the setup controls: cross, triangle, square, circle, R, L, and select have been added, i need to work on some more stuff like a screen that reads "Made With PSP Game Maker" Intro.

    and some other stuff.. be checking my website for updates please.

    ----------------------------------
    please dont expect much from the first cuple of relases, this is from the ground up and the first couple of releases will only deal with "static" sprites.
    with no animation support. you will probably be able to make games like pong and brak out probably.

    and only .jpg support for the first few versions.(because VB6 does not support .png files) I have to find a way around some limitations.
